4. The Battle Of New York - The Avengers (2012)

Joss Whedon did a hell of a job in what was only his second theatrical feature, one that brought Marvel Studios' Phase 1 to a hugely satisfying end and also resulted in the third highest-grossing movie in history. One of the most crowd-pleasing blockbusters in recent memory, The Avengers overcomes a slow first act and several plot contrivances to deliver a climactic battle that had audiences around the world punching the air in delight. As Loki leads a Chitauri invasion of New York, Earth's Mightiest Heroes need to work together in order to stop the evil Asgardian and his extra-terrestrial minions. Which is exactly what they do, in an incredible extended set-piece that offers massive-scale action as well as plenty of humor. Each member of the team gets a chance to shine in amongst the city-destroying chaos, with the highlight being a stunning tracking shot that follows the Avengers as they fight back against the alien invaders (even Hawkeye gets something to do!), capped off by a brilliant moment between the Hulk and Thor. Next summer's Age of Ultron will need to have something pretty special up its sleeve in order to top this showdown.
